Hexapeptide with hypoglycemic effect and preparation and application thereof

The invention discloses a hexapeptide with a hypoglycemic effect as well as a preparation method and application thereof, and belongs to the technical field of biological medicines. The amino acid sequence of the hexapeptide is Ile-Trp-Asp-Pro-His-Phe, and the amino acid sequence of the hexapeptide is as shown in the specification. The novel hexapeptide IWDPHF with prominent DPP-IV inhibition ability is successfully identified from mulberry leaf proteolysis products through liquid chromatography-mass spectrometry and a virtual screening method, the hexapeptide IWDPHF shows the blood glucose reducing effect superior to that of part of known peptides in an in-vitro enzyme activity inhibition experiment and a zebra fish hyperglycemia model, and no obvious side effect exists; the compound has a good potential of being developed into a hypoglycemic functional product or a drug lead compound. The invention further provides the mulberry leaf peptide with the peptide fragment IWDPHF, and the mulberry leaf peptide can be applied to preparation of drugs or food for reducing blood sugar. The invention provides a new scheme and theoretical basis for treatment of diabetes, and has good market prospect and application potential.

Marine source bioactive peptide with blood sugar reducing effect, preparation and application

The invention discloses a marine-derived bioactive peptide with a blood sugar reducing effect, a preparation and application, and belongs to the technical field of bioactive peptides. The amino acid sequence of the bioactive peptide is at least one of FYP, FPF and YAPFPK. Three bioactive peptides with the blood sugar reducing effect are separated and purified from oysters through enzymolysis, ultrafiltration, gel chromatography, liquid chromatography-mass spectrometry and bioinformatics technologies. According to the present invention, chemical synthesis is performed according to the identified peptide fragment sequence, the hypoglycemic activity of the synthesized single peptide fragment and the compounded peptide fragment is detected, and the bioactive peptides have good alpha-glucosidase inhibition activity, such that the bioactive peptides have good application prospects in the preparation of the products with the hypoglycemic effect, and can be widely used in the preparation of the products with the hypoglycemic effect. And a foundation is laid for high value-added utilization of oysters and promotion of research, development and application of functional active peptides.

Composition for enhancing the blood glucose-lowering effect of sulfonylurea drugs

To provide an adjuvant that can maintain the therapeutic effect while reducing the dose of the SU drugs since sulfonylurea drugs (hereinafter also referred to as "SU drugs"'), which are antidiabetic drugs, induce pancreatic β cell exhaustion when used long-term in addition to the side effects of hypoglycemia and weight gain and have side effects of reduced efficacy (hypoglycemic effect) and renal damage.SOLUTION: If D-allulose is administered before or simultaneously with SU drug administration, the hypoglycemic effect of SU drugs will be enhanced. As a result, the above-mentioned problem is solved because the dose of SU drugs can be significantly reduced. Furthermore, since D-allulose has been eaten by humans, it can provide a highly safe drug when combined with SU drugs.SELECTED DRAWING: Figure 3

Pharmaceutical formulation comprising glucokinase activator and use thereof

Provided herein are pharmaceutical formulations comprising glucokinase activator, or a prodrug, or a pharmaceutically acceptable salt, an isotope labeled analogue, a crystalline form, a hydrate, a solvate, or a diastereomeric or enantiomeric form thereof and the use thereof for treating diseases; the pharmaceutical formulations are in the form of immediate-release formulations, extended-release formulations, or combination of immediate-release formulation and extended-release formulations. The pharmaceutical formulations achieved once-a-day therapy for some diseases, in particular, type II Diabetes Mellitus with obesity. The pharmaceutical formulations exhibit sustained 24 hours of glucose-lowering effects. The pharmaceutical formulations also achieved lower Cmax, extended T1 / 2 as well as maintained similar bioavailability and increased MRT compared with commercial Dorzagliatin tablet, enhanced the pharmacology effect of restoring the glucose stimulated GLP-1 secretion in diabetes with obesity.

Preparation method of pea oligopeptide and application of pea oligopeptide in reducing blood sugar

The invention belongs to the technical field of plant peptide preparation, and particularly relates to a preparation method of pea oligopeptide and application of the pea oligopeptide in the aspect of reducing blood sugar. The pea oligopeptide is prepared by taking pea protein as a raw material through an enzymolysis method, core peptide fragments VA, FPW and WPF of the pea oligopeptide are obtained through further identification on the basis, and VA, FPW and WPF are screened and confirmed as potential inhibitory peptides targeting DPP-IV by combining molecular docking and molecular dynamics simulation technologies. Besides, the DPP-IV inhibition rate of the core peptide fragment is further determined through an in-vitro experiment, and the FPW and the WPF are confirmed to be the core peptide fragment with efficient DPP-IV inhibition potential and have relatively good structural stability by combining cell experiment analysis, so that theoretical support is provided for the hypoglycemic effect of the pea peptide core peptide fragment, and a foundation is laid for development of hypoglycemic nutritional and healthy products.
